Mille Bornes
All details & ratingMille Bornes is a classic French card game that simulates a car race where players strive to travel 1000 kilometers (the titular "One Thousand Milestones") on the roads of France. The game is a fun blend of strategy and luck, as players navigate through various road hazards and challenges to reach their destination first.

Explore Europe
All details & ratingA game for on-the-go play. Each player has a home city and draws 6 cards for other cities they must visit through a combination of land, sea, and air travel. Players use a die to draw, but they choose their own routes. The limitation of using only one mode of transportation per turn adds to the analysis and decision-making. The first player to visit all their cities and return home wins.
